This PR reworks the Tallbridge fleet fuel-usage report to aggregate per-depot rather than per-vehicle, fixing the double-counting seen in the Ashgrove rollout. All figures were cross-checked against last quarter's manual audit. Please review the smoothing and outlier thresholds carefully, as they directly affect the published numbers.

constants for fawep-yagap:
QUOTAS = {
    "noveth": 275,
    "oliion": 740,
}

☐ Step 4 — Slimforge image attestation: verify the slimmed container digest matches the ceremony manifest, confirm stripped layers are logged, and sign with the ceremony key. No base-image substitutions after this point. Unsealing the attestation vault prompts for the recovery passphrase; release manager reads it from this record. It is as follows.

recovery phrase for bawef-kagug: casix-tamvan-lamath-holeth-gilmir-drudor-julax-wenok-wenael-rusvan-holax-goriel-frawyn

# Moving Cron Jobs to Marlinflow

Welcome aboard! Historically, the Pebbleworks data team ran nightly jobs via plain cron on a single box, which made build provenance basically guesswork. We're migrating everything to Marlinflow, our workflow engine, so each run records its inputs, the commit it was built from, and who triggered it. If you add a new job, skip crontab entirely. Every migrated pipeline stamps its output with a provenance token, shown below for reference.

build token for yahip-kagug: htk9_39c075c81

## Gleamwharf Environments: Upload Encoding Detection

For this week's sync: Gleamwharf's encoding detector for uploaded text files behaves differently across environments, which explains the mismatched test results Priya reported. Staging uses an aggressive confidence threshold and falls back to a Latin-1 assumption, while production requires higher confidence and rejects ambiguous files outright. Please review carefully before we unify the two. The production detector currently runs with the following settings.

config for kagup-hahig:
druwyn:
  pin: 2801
  metrics_host: metrics.druwyn.zemvarlabs.internal
  tenant: sorius
  seal: seal_798a43d7